Speaker Bio: Vanessa Chau, P.Eng., MIAM, CAMA Strategic Infrastructure Leader | Asset Management Executive | ESG & AI Transformation Advocate
Vanessa Chau is a nationally recognized infrastructure strategist and executive advisor with over 25 years of experience leading enterprise-wide transformation across both public and private sectors. Her career spans multimillion-dollar portfolios in municipal government, transit, and consulting, where she has consistently delivered sustainable outcomes through data-driven strategies, inclusive governance, and stakeholder engagement.
Vanessa is the founding architect of the City of Brampton’s Corporate Asset Management Office, where she implemented one of Canada’s first ISO 55000-aligned governance models—featured in Public Sector Digest as a national best practice. Her recent work with the Toronto Transit Commission (TTC) earned her the Service Transformation Award, recognizing her leadership in modernizing asset management practices and embedding ESG principles into capital planning.
As a founding board member of Asset Management Ontario- Canada and Women in Asset Management North America (WiAM NA), Vanessa has helped shape policy and practice at the intersection of infrastructure, equity, and innovation. Her thought leadership has been featured in ReNew Canada, ES&E Magazine, and international forums focused on AI, sustainability, and strategic workforce planning.
Vanessa’s presentations blend technical insight with visionary leadership, offering audiences practical tools and bold ideas for integrating AI, ESG, and Triple Bottom Line frameworks into asset-intensive organizations. She is a passionate advocate for treating people as the most critical assets in any transformation journey.
